Organisational mergers and acquisitions: The importance of culture change

mergers and acquisitions

An interesting paper has just been published looking at the role culture change plays in mergers and acquisitions. The researchers estimate that approximately 30% of all mergers and acquisitions that fail to meet their objectives and outcomes, do so because of a clash of organisational cultures within the new merged organisation.
